Lyria 3 is a sophisticated AI music generation system developed by Google as part of the Gemini suite, designed to create high-fidelity, 30-second musical compositions from simple text descriptions or uploaded images. This advanced tool is engineered for a broad spectrum of users, from creative professionals and content creators to everyday individuals seeking to add a personalized audio dimension to their projects or memories. Its primary purpose is to democratize music creation by removing the need for technical musical expertise, allowing anyone to generate original, complete tracks featuring instrumentals, vocals, and coherent lyrics based purely on conceptual prompts. The system interprets the emotional and thematic cues within a user's input to produce a tailored soundtrack that aligns with the intended mood, style, or narrative, effectively bridging the gap between abstract ideas and tangible musical expression.

One of the most powerful feature groups of Lyria 3 is its multimodal prompt understanding, which accepts both textual descriptions and visual imagery as input for music generation. When provided with a text prompt, the AI deeply analyzes the language to extract key elements such as genre, tempo, emotional tone, instrumentation, and thematic keywords, constructing a complex internal representation of the desired musical output. For image-based prompts, the system employs advanced computer vision techniques to interpret the scene, colors, subjects, and implied atmosphere, translating these visual attributes into corresponding musical characteristics—a serene landscape might yield a calm, ambient piece, while a bustling cityscape could generate an upbeat, rhythmic track. This dual-input capability ensures users can inspire music from virtually any source of inspiration, making the creative process incredibly intuitive and accessible.

A second major feature group is the generation of complete, polished musical tracks that include not just instrumental backing but also AI-synthesized vocals and contextually relevant lyrics. The system doesn't merely produce melodies; it builds full arrangements with layered instruments, dynamic progression, and a cohesive structure that mimics human-composed music. The vocal synthesis is engineered to sound natural and emotive, capable of adapting to different singing styles dictated by the prompt. Furthermore, the AI lyricist component generates original lyrical content that aligns with the theme and mood of the prompt, ensuring the vocals are meaningful and integrated rather than generic placeholders. This end-to-end generation results in a radio-ready 30-second audio file that stands as a finished piece of music.

Technically, Lyria 3 operates on a foundation of large-scale generative AI models, likely built upon transformer-based architectures similar to those used in advanced language and image models, but specifically trained on massive datasets of music, lyrics, and their associated metadata. The training process involves learning the intricate relationships between descriptive language, visual elements, and the corresponding audio waveforms, musical notation, and lyrical content. When a user submits a prompt, the model engages in a complex inference process: encoding the input, traversing a latent space of musical possibilities, and decoding that into a sequence of audio signals, synchronized lyrical phonemes, and instrumental arrangements that collectively form a coherent track. The output is constrained to a 30-second duration, optimizing for shareability and practical use in digital content.

Concrete use cases illustrate its practical application across diverse workflows. A social media manager could upload an image from a new marketing campaign and generate an upbeat, branded jingle to use in promotional Reels or TikTok videos within the same workflow. An indie game developer, lacking a budget for a composer, could describe the setting of a mystical forest level to receive an atmospheric, orchestral piece fitting for that game scene. A teacher creating an educational video about space could prompt for 'epic, wonder-filled synth music' to underscore the visuals of nebulae and planets. An individual could turn a series of vacation photos into a personalized song with lyrics referencing the location, creating a novel and memorable digital scrapbook.
